Assessor II

The City of Rochester, NH is accepting applications for a full-time Assessor II to perform technical field and office work in support of the assessing activities of the department. The majority of work is performed independently, in accordance with standard practices, state and local statutes, regulations, guidelines and previous training. Work requires a high degree of judgmental reasoning to perform appraisals of real property. Generally establishes own daily work plan and prioritizes and organizes, in order to complete work assignments. 

Special Requirements 

• Associate degree or equivalent from a two-year college or technical school, in real estate appraisal or related subject, or 3-5 years of training and experience in appraisal and assessment practices

• Possession of a valid driver’s license

• DRA Certified Property Assessor designation or the ability to obtain within one year required 

RMEA grade 10; Pay range $28.18 to $37.97 dependent upon qualifications and experience with competitive benefits. Pre-employment testing will include criminal, driving record, medical & drug screen.
